    Polarizer Film. A POLARIZER is an optical filter that allows light of a specific polarization to pass through and block waves of others. Common types are linear polarizers and circular polarizers. It is usually made of polymer composite, laminated by dye and stretched PVA and TAC.

    A polarizing filter, also referred to as a polarizer, is an optical filter that is attached to the front of a camera lens. This kind of filters is mostly used to enhance contrast, reduce glare and atmospheric haze in landscape photography.     Polarizing portraits. Polarizing a portrait not only makes the sky, foliage, and buildings more rich and vibrant, it also removes much of the shininess on a person’s face. Oil on skin reflects light, making a shiny appearance. In the portrait below, my subject had just had makeup done (by Denise Christensen) so her shine was already minimal.
